Summary
- The war experiences of T.E. Lawrence, a young British officer, who helped lead the revolt of Arab tribes against the Turks during the World War I desert campaign.

Notes
- - LP25769 U.S. Copyright Office
- - Copyright: Horizon Pictures Ltd.; 19Dec62; LP25769.
- - According to the Academy Awards database, the Writers Guild of America found that Micheal Wilson and Robert Bolt share the credit for the screenplay.
- - Note on MI Film and Television catalog card: "Cannot be viewed; should be archival positive" (i.e., non-viewing print).
- - Filmed in Super-Panavision 70 and Technicolor.
- - Originally released in both 70 mm and 35 mm.
- - LC also holds a theatrical projection print of the restored version in the AFI/Columbia (Sony) Collection, a laser videodisc viewing copy of the restored version in the Copyright Collection, a laser videodisc version in the LC Purchase Collection, and a DVD viewing copy in the Roger Blunck Collection.
